How they compare

Mauritius currently reports -1.59 billion current US$ against -1.61 billion current US$ in Armenia, a difference of 16.01 million current US$.

The two have swapped places 4 times across 36 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Mauritius ahead.

Armenia ranks 125th and Mauritius ranks 124th of 192 countries.

Across the 4 decades both report, Armenia averaged higher in 1 and Mauritius in 3.

Head to head by decade

Decade Armenia Mauritius Difference Ahead
1990s -442.09 million current US$ -141.19 million current US$ 300.90 million current US$ Mauritius
2000s -1.17 billion current US$ -355.06 million current US$ 818.19 million current US$ Mauritius
2010s -1.85 billion current US$ -963.22 million current US$ 882.52 million current US$ Mauritius
2020s -863.69 million current US$ -1.52 billion current US$ 656.03 million current US$ Armenia

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The balance of international trade in goods and services is the difference between the exports and imports of goods and services. This indicator is expressed in current prices, meaning no adjustment has been made to account for price changes over time. This indicator is expressed in United States dollars.
